在成功运行之后,我尝试将标识用户Id类型更改为Guid:{
public string Name { get“IdentityDbContext”中的类型参数“TUser”。没有从'AuthServer.Infrastructure.Data.Identity.AppUser‘到“Microsoft.AspNetCore.Identity.IdentityUser”
我正在尝试从代码优先模型创建数据库。).AddEntityFrameworkStores<AppWebContext, int>() var res = services我是ASP.net和ASP.NET Core的新手。完全错误:
An error occurred while starting the application.of <
我在现有的应用程序中使用ASP.NET核心标识2.0实现了身份验证。当我使用自己的数据库模式和类时,我使用自己的用户类,并且必须创建一个自定义UserStore。问题是,当我创建用户时,我不使用标识中使用的相同方法对他们的密码进行散列,当调用此函数时,登录失败:
var result = await _signInManager.PasswordSignInAsync(model.Login, mo
我首先使用ASP.NET标识提供程序和EF 6代码,并创建了一个具有额外列OrganisationId的自定义IdentityUserRole表。自定义表名为UserRole。Role, IdentityUserClaim>public class Role : IdentityRole<string, UserRole>
在泛型类型或方法>‘中,类型'MyNamespace.Model.En
我试图在Visual 2015中使用和ASP.NET Core 1.0.1构建身份服务器。标识作为我在中描述的标识服务器中的用户存储。默认情况下,ASP.NET标识使用string作为所有表的键,但我希望使用int,因此我对它们进行了如下更改:
public class AppUserToken : IdentityUserToken上得到了一个构建错误: